Montalcino is a land where vines have coexisted with the landscape for centuries, shaping harmonious hills, forests, and orderly vineyards. The rich and diverse soils, combined with a climate characterized by good temperature ranges and favorable sun exposure, allow Sangiovese to express itself with great aromatic precision. From this context, a wine is born, designed not to be aged for a long time, but to offer immediate pleasureIn doing so, Rosso di Montalcino Castelnovo does not give up the depth that distinguishes the area.

From an olfactory point of view, the profile is clean, elegant and recognizable. The aromas of emerge clearly on the nose ripe cherry, juicy and well-defined. This represents one of the distinctive traits of the Sangiovese grown on these hills. This is accompanied by floral notes of violet, delicate but persistent, capable of giving finesse and verticality to the bouquet. In the background you can perceive light spicy nuances, never invasive. These nuances add complexity without weighing down the overall effect, keeping the wine fresh and harmonious.

The tasting fully confirms the sensations anticipated by the nose. On the palate the sip is balanced and smooth, built on a measured structure that favors drinkability and gustatory precision. lively acidity, a distinctive feature of Sangiovese, supports the wine from start to finish, giving it momentum and making it particularly dynamic. This natural freshness perfectly balances the fruity component, avoiding any sensation of heaviness and making the sip agile and inviting. The tannins are present but fine and well integrated, contributing to an elegant texture that accompanies the palate with discretion.

Grapes

Grapes

Pure Sangiovese
Alcoholic content

Alcoholic content

13% vol.
Service temperature

Service temperature

16–18 °C
Recommended glass

Recommended glass

Wide glass for medium-bodied red wine.
pairing

Food pairing

It pairs well with first courses with ragù, roast meats and medium-aged Tuscan cheeses.
